All About Protein

Monday, 10 August 2009

Proteins are very important to our bodies. It isn't just for bodybuilders who use them to gain muscle mass. Those who are sick use them to rebuild damaged tissue and even in normal states
our body uses protein for many different tasks.

Proteins are made of amino acids that are folded together. There are essential amino acids - those that our body cannot make
and non essential amino acids - those that our body can make. Proteins that are made up of all the essential amino acids are said to be complete while those that lack in one or more essential amino acid are incomplete. Complete proteins come from sources such as meat
eggs
cheese
dairy and soy. Incomplete proteins come mainly from vegetable sources with the one exception being soy.

The ideal source should be complete proteins. For most people that isn't a problem. If you are worried about fat intake
try lean cuts of beef
chicken and turkey. For vegetarians whose main source comes from incomplete proteins
getting a variety of vegetables and whole grains throughout the day will ensure that all essential amino acids are consumed. Also
using soy protein (which is the only complete vegetable source of protein) is very beneficial.
